

















Live Dealer Blackjack Fundamentals: Building Your Foundation
Live dealer blackjack brings the casino floor straight to your screen. Real cards are dealt by a human croupier, streamed in high‑definition video. The game follows the same basic rules you know from brick‑and‑mortar tables.
The objective is simple: beat the dealer’s hand without exceeding 21. Each card’s value is clear—2‑10 are face value, J‑Q‑K count as 10, and Aces can be 1 or 11. The “hit” and “stand” options let you control the flow of the hand.
RTP (return‑to‑player) for live blackjack usually sits between 99.2 % and 99.6 %, depending on the rule set. Lower house edges mean more chances for skilled players to profit over time.
Understanding the difference between Classic, European, and VIP versions is key. Classic allows the dealer to peek for a natural blackjack; European does not, which changes basic strategy slightly. VIP tables often raise minimum bets but may offer side‑bet bonuses.

Card Counting Basics
While live dealers shuffle automatically, some tables use a shoe with 6‑8 decks. Keep a simple Hi‑Lo count: +1 for low cards (2‑6), –1 for high cards (10‑A). When the count is positive, increase your bet slightly.
